Jouvan Laali currently serves as the Head of Digital Marketing at American Girl, a position held since January 2020. Prior to this role, Jouvan was the Executive Director of Digital Marketing at The Walt Disney Company, where oversight included branded content partnerships and influencer strategy. From November 2012 to September 2019, Jouvan held a similar position at Twentieth Century Fox, leading digital marketing for over 25 film releases annually. Previously, Jouvan worked as Director of Digital Marketing and Digital Marketing Manager at Warner Home Video, managing campaigns for high-profile films such as The Dark Knight and Harry Potter. Jouvan's career also includes a Digital Marketing Manager role at Paramount Pictures and a coordinator position at Warner Bros. Entertainment. Jouvan holds a BA in Economics and Electrical Engineering from UC Santa Barbara.

Mattel is a leading global toy company and owner of one of the strongest catalogs of children’s and family entertainment franchises in the world. They create innovative products and experiences that inspire, entertain and develop children through play. They engage consumers through their portfolio of iconic brands, including Barbie®, Hot Wheels®, Fisher-Price®, American Girl®, Thomas & Friends®, UNO® and MEGA®, as well as other popular intellectual properties that we own or license in partnership with global entertainment companies. Their offerings include film and television content, gaming, music and live events. They operate in 35 locations and their products are available in more than 150 countries in collaboration with the world’s leading retail and ecommerce companies. Since its founding in 1945, Mattel is proud to be a trusted partner in empowering children to explore the wonder of childhood and reach their full potential.
